Synopsis

Telling the story of the rise of progressive women's movements amidst the climate of political repression and economic crisis enveloping Brazil in the 1970s, this book pays attention to the gender politics of the final stages of regime transition in the 1980s. It is useful for students and teachers of Latin American politics.
